In the last year, MLB lost some very good people. One of those is Yordano Ventura. Prior to the opening of the Kansas City Royals’ spring training game against the Texas Rangers, Adrian Beltre and Carlos Gomez honored the 25-year-old in a very touching way.
Adrian Beltre, Carlos Gomez honored Yordano Ventura by placing flowers on pitching mound
A touching tribute by Beltre and Gomez.


Gomez and Beltre, like Ventura, hail from the Dominican Republic. And according to the Dallas Morning News, Gomez and Ventura had a friendly relationship.
“I feel so bad about it,” Gomez said. “This just shows that you have to live life every day. Nobody but God knows what is next.”
On Jan. 22, the world received the tragic news of Ventura’s death as the result of a car crash in his home country of the Dominican Republic.
In 2016, Ventura went 11-12 with a 4.45 ERA. He collected 144 strikeouts and posted a 1.44 WHIP. His fastball was freakish with velocity some times topping 100 miles per hour. Some argued he might be the hardest throwing starting pitcher ever.
